SPARROW
House Sparrows were brought to America from England in the 1850’s. They rapidly spread and are obviously quite common. They are about 5-6 inches long, have a variety of markings, and have a voice that makes many “cheeping” sounds. They routinely eat seeds, grains, some insects, and occasionally vegetable matter. Sparrows will sometimes enter a house by way of the chimney, and can be a problem to remove if large numbers have entered. They can carry many diseases, parasites, and viruses, and are a major source of Eastern Encephalitis which spreads especially among children.

Life Cycle
Nests are made in secluded spots on and inside buildings, birdhouses, hollow trees--pretty much in any urban areas. Between three and eight eggs are laid, which hatch in 11-17 days. Young sparrows can then fly in about 15 days. Several generations (two to five) can be produced in the same nest during the spring and summer.
